U-21 USWNT Edged by Germany, Still Claim Highest Junior World Cup Finish
SANTIAGO, Chile – Despite falling to No. 3 Germany, 3-1, in their final match, the No. 6 U.S. U-21 Women’s National Team closed out the 2025 FIH Hockey Women’s Junior World Cup with their highest-ever finish of 6th place.
From the start, the 5th/6th placement game promised to be a good one. The first quarter saw very few offensive opportunities, but a slight favor toward Germany. With less than a minute remaining, Germany had perhaps their best chance so far when a crossed ball found a player a post. The ball slipped past Alyssa Klebasko but was cleared off the line by Josie Hollamon.
Germany, who had been looking for a penalty corner all match, finally earned one in the 27th minute. A drag flick from Lena Frerichs gave them a 1-0 lead heading into halftime. Die Danas then doubled their advantage early in the third quarter to 2-0, and hinging off that momentum, tallied another just minutes later to go up 3-0.
In the final minute of the third frame, Germany earned a penalty stroke, but a sensational save from Alyssa Klebasko denied them the goal.
Revitalized, it was the Junior Eagles with the final goal—their first and only of the match—in the 51st minute from Dani Mendez off the proceeding play from Ella Beach.
A few saves from substitute goalkeeper Juliana Boon helped USA end the match with no further injury, as Germany won 3-1 to take 5th place while USA claimed the 6th place spot, their best-ever finish at a Junior World Cup.
Key Moments:
- 14' Josie Hollamon clears it off the goal line
- 27' Germany earns the first penalty corner, scores on a drag flick to take 1-0 lead
- 32' Germany scores in open play to go up 2-0
- 37' Germany tip in another goal to take 3-0 lead
- 44' A second Germany penalty corner is defended by USA
- 45' Germany penalty stroke called, USA reviews and loses video referral
- 45' Alyssa Klebasko denies Germany's penalty stroke
- 51' Ella Beach dribbles in and sends the ball to Dani Mendez, who finishes in goal
- 52' Germany set piece chance
- 58' Germany penalty corner
Noteworthy:
- The U-21 USWNT had their best-ever finish at a Junior World Cup (6th), the last being a 7th place finish in 2013
